Roof hole covers?
I believe they are called a Clam Shell Vent and come in various sizes.

On Mon, Jun 9, 2008 at 6:47 PM, Scott Forman <"sforman@renasant.com"> wrote:



I don't know the "proper" name for what I am looking for, but here

goes. On the few places on the roof that wires come up through a hole

(the musical horn speaker wires, for instance), there is a metal screw

on cover over the hole with a ridge allowing the wire to exit the

cover. When the previous owner installed the satellite, he found

something similar to use on that hole. Any idea where I might find

something like this?
